The Old School House is an independent special school in Wisbech for boys aged 6 to 16. It has 11 pupils and room for 15.

Crime figures come from police.uk. The police record each crime at the nearest of a fixed set of map points rather than the exact spot, so “within 500 m” is only rough. House prices are from HM Land Registry sales nearby over the last two years.
